A hybrid inverter combines the functionalities of a solar inverter and a battery inverter. It converts direct current (DC) from solar panels into alternating current (AC) for home use while also managing the charging and discharging of battery storage systems. [pdf]

Six cells are placed in one container, and they are connected in series. Each cell is 2 volts, so when six cells are connected, the battery becomes 12 volts. After placing the cells inside the battery container, they are welded together using a welding machine. [pdf]

Note!The battery size will be based on running your inverter at its full capacity Assumptions 1. Modified sine wave inverter efficiency: 85% 2. Pure sine wave inverter efficiency:90% 3. Lithium Battery:100% Depth of discharge limit 4. lead-acid Battery:50% Depth of discharge limit Instructions!. .
To calculate the battery capacity for your inverter use this formula Inverter capacity (W)*Runtime (hrs)/solar system voltage = Battery Size*1.15 Multiply the result by 2 for lead-acid type. .
You would need around 24v150Ah Lithium or 24v 300Ah Lead-acid Batteryto run a 3000-watt inverter for 1 hour at its full capacity .
